JOSEPH FISHER
Joseph Fisher of Route 4, Knox, died Thursday, April 15 at 12:15 a.m. at his home following a 3 1/2 year illness. He was born in Starke County and was 79 years of age at the time of his passing. He was a life-long farmer in this county and was well-known in this area.
He was married February 14, 1907 in this county to Clara Rivers, who preceded him in death. To this union seven children were born, three sons: Perry, Cecil, Ralph at home; four daughters, Mrs. Alice Skibbe, Mrs. Grace Fort of Knox, Mrs. Hazel Myers of Plymouth and Blanche Budka of Knox, who survive.
He was later re-married in September 1924 to Evelyn Sweet of Tacoma, Washington, who survives. To them were 13 children born, five sons: Walter, Raymond of Knox, Howard of North Judson, and Marvin and Melvin at home; eight daughters, Dorothy Tunis of North Judson, Helen Simuni, Mae Crosby, Shirley Sitek, Gloria Shannon, all of Knox, Clara Saine of North Judson, and Patsy Overmyer of Monterey. One daughter, Betty Fisher preceded him in death in February 1939. Also surviving are 53 grandchildren; 29 great-grandchildren; two brothers, George of Knox and Frank of North Judson; and one sister, Mary Billick of Knox.
Friends may call at the Harry Price Funeral Home after 7 p.m. Thursday. Funeral services are to be Saturday at 2 p.m. at the funeral home with Rufus Gerkin, pastor, officiating. Burial is to be in the Round Lake Cemetery.

Obituary published in the Starke County Democrat on April 15, 1965.
